Heat Levels: From Sweet to Spicy


One of the most distinctive features of love fiction is the range of heat levels available, dealing with every reader's convenience zone and choice. At the sweeter end, tidy love and wholesome love keep physical intimacy off the page, focusing instead on emotional connection, sincere gestures, and often a faith-centered or family-oriented perspective. Closed-door love might include sexual tension however fades to black before specific details.


On the other side of the spectrum, steamy romance and spicy romance delve into high-heat encounters, frequently checking out the physical side of destination in detail. High heat romance pushes the limits further, integrating sensuality as a core part of character development and plot. Many readers delight in moving between these levels depending upon their state of mind, making the range within the genre an essential reason for its mass appeal.

Emotional Beats and Reader Satisfaction


While the specifics vary, many romance novels are built around certain emotional beats that readers prepare for. There's the meet-cute or preliminary trigger, where chemistry sparks. Stress develops through moments of attraction, misunderstanding, and vulnerability, culminating in a central pivotal moment where characters need to make essential options.


Romance readers also anticipate a gratifying resolution, frequently referred to as a "HEA" (Happily Ever After) or "HFN" (Happy For Now). In clean love, this may indicate a proposal, marriage, or heartfelt dedication, Read more while in steamy love, it might include a more enthusiastic statement. The assurance of an emotionally rewarding ending is among the genre's greatest conveniences-- it allows readers to enjoy the low and high of a story, understanding love will ultimately dominate.
